Web18 sep. 2024 · A lone king against the edge of the board is easily checkmated by any two major pieces. While one piece prevents the king from moving away from the edge, the other can move to the same rank or file as the king to deliver a checkmate. There are six different types of chess pieces. Each side starts with 16 pieces: eight pawns, two bishops, two knights, two rooks, one queen, and one king. Let's meet them! The squares forming the horizontal part of the chessboard are named a to h. great meadow bhuWeb2 sep. 2008 · So you'll maintain 12 UInt64 variables to represent your chess board: two (one black and one white) for each piece type, namely, pawn, rook, knight, bishop, queen and king. Every bit in a UInt64 will correspond to a square on chessboard.
